To generate debug output:
1. In the InstallAnywhere Advanced Designer, highlight the launcher.
2. Click the Edit Properties button.
3. Alter the values for the following variables:
lax.stderr.redirect= AND lax.stdout.redirect= to be:
lax.stderr.redirect=output.txt AND lax.stdout.redirect=output.txt
4. After a normal installation, edit the .lax file as described in the preceding
instructions.
5. This procedure will have to be repeated for each installation.
